This media file captures an exhibition display titled "SISTEM IRIGASI & Alat Mesin Pertanian" (Irrigation System & Agricultural Machinery Tools) against a dark, textured wall. Two spotlights illuminate the top portion of the display.

The exhibit features four historical, monochrome photographs arranged in two rows and two columns, showcasing early irrigation and agricultural practices, likely in the Bogor region of Indonesia, given the context.

**Photo 1 (Top Left):** Depicts a water gate or intake structure by a river or canal, with a rocky embankment on the side. A person appears to be standing near the water. The caption reads "Pintu air di sungai untuk irigasi," followed by "Bogor, 1930."

**Photo 2 (Top Right):** Shows a group of people, presumably workers, engaged in the construction or preparation of an irrigation canal. They are moving materials, possibly using carts or hand tools. A building with a thatched roof is visible in the background. The caption mentions "Pekerja sedang mengadakan persiapan kanal untuk irigasi, Subak Mekar..." with a date of "1910" faintly visible.

**Photo 3 (Bottom Left):** Presents a larger dam or weir structure with multiple gates spanning a body of water. Water is clearly flowing through the open gates. The caption states "Pintu air untuk irigasi," and "Bogor, 1930" is visible.

**Photo 4 (Bottom Right):** Features several men operating machinery, possibly a mechanism for opening or closing a water gate, set on a wooden structure. A thatched-roof building is also present in the background. The caption describes "Pengoperasian pintu air [likely gerbang, meaning gate, rather than garasi] di Subak Mekar, Ciawi, Bogor, 1920."

The overall scene provides a historical look into irrigation infrastructure and agricultural labor from the early 20th century in Bogor, Indonesia.
